Grilled Mexican Shrimp Salad is a vibrant and flavorful dish that brings the zest of Mexico to your table. This refreshing salad features marinated grilled shrimp, smoky corn, and a medley of fresh vegetables. Perfect for summer gatherings, weeknight dinners, or meal prep, it’s a versatile recipe that satisfies both your taste buds and nutritional needs. With its colorful presentation and delightful texture, this salad is sure to impress family and friends alike!
Why You’ll Love This Recipe
- Delicious Flavor: The combination of ancho chili powder, fresh thyme, and garlic creates an irresistible marinade for the shrimp.
- Quick to Prepare: With just 30 minutes from prep to plate, this dish is perfect for busy weeknights.
- Nutritious Ingredients: Packed with protein from shrimp, fiber from black beans, and healthy fats from avocado, it’s a wholesome meal.
- Versatile Serving Options: Serve it as a main course or as a side dish at barbecues and parties.
- Eye-Catching Presentation: The vibrant colors of the ingredients make this salad visually appealing.

Tools and Preparation
To create this delicious Grilled Mexican Shrimp Salad, you’ll need some essential tools. Having the right equipment will make preparation smooth and efficient.
Essential Tools and Equipment
- Grill
- Mixing bowl
- Wooden skewers
- Grill brush
- Knife
- Cutting board
Importance of Each Tool
- Grill: This is crucial for achieving the perfect char on the shrimp and corn while enhancing their flavors.
- Mixing Bowl: A large bowl helps in easily combining all salad ingredients without spilling.
- Knives: Sharp knives ensure clean cuts for vegetables, making preparation easier and safer.
Ingredients
For the Shrimp:
- 1 lb large raw shrimp (fresh or thawed from frozen, peeled and deveined)
- 1/4 cup olive oil
- 1 1/2 tbsp fresh thyme (chopped)
- 1 1/2 tbsp ancho chili powder (this ingredient is key for incredible flavor)
- 1 tsp fresh lime zest
- 4 cloves garlic (chopped)
- Wooden skewers (soaked in water for at least 30 minutes)
For the Salad:
- 2 ears fresh corn (husks and silk removed)
- Olive oil or avocado oil cooking spray
- Coarse salt and pepper (for seasoning the corn and salad)
- 6-8 cups green leaf lettuce (can also use butter or romaine lettuce, chopped)
- 15 oz can black beans (rinsed and drained)
- 1 large tomato (seeded and chopped)
- 1 lg avocado (chopped)
- 4 oz queso fresco cheese (crumbled)
- Fresh chopped cilantro: for garnishing, if desired
How to Make Grilled Mexican Shrimp Salad
Step 1: Preheat the Grill
Start by preheating the grill over medium heat. Use a grill brush to clean the grate thoroughly before cooking.
Step 2: Prepare the Marinade
Whisk together the olive oil, fresh chopped thyme, ancho chili powder, lime zest, and garlic in a bowl. Pat the shrimp dry with paper towels. Thread them onto wooden skewers. Brush each skewer with the chili lime marinade until well coated. Season lightly with salt and pepper.
Step 3: Grill the Corn
Spray the corn with olive oil spray. Season it with a pinch or two of salt. Grill the corn for 14-16 minutes, turning every 4 minutes until tender. Once grilled, set it aside to cool down.
Step 4: Grill the Shrimp
Increase grill heat to high. Place skewers on the grill; cook shrimp for about 1 1/2 minutes on each side until golden brown and no longer pink. Sprinkle with coarse kosher salt.
Step 5: Assemble Your Salad
In a large mixing bowl, add your salad greens first. Scrape corn off its cob into the bowl along with chopped tomatoes, black beans, queso fresco cheese, avocado chunks, and fresh cilantro if desired. Finally, place grilled shrimp on top before serving.
Serve your Grilled Mexican Shrimp Salad with cilantro lime vinaigrette or any dressing of your choice! Enjoy!
How to Serve Grilled Mexican Shrimp Salad
Grilled Mexican Shrimp Salad is delicious and versatile, making it a perfect dish for various occasions. Here are some serving suggestions to enhance your dining experience.
For a Casual Meal
- Serve the salad in large bowls for a relaxed family dinner. This presentation allows everyone to dig in and enjoy.
As an Appetizer
- Present small portions in individual cups or jars. This option makes for an elegant starter at parties.
With Tortilla Chips
- Pair the salad with crispy tortilla chips. The crunch complements the creamy avocado and grilled shrimp beautifully.
Over Rice or Quinoa
- Serve the salad on a bed of rice or quinoa. This addition makes the dish heartier and adds more texture.
With Dressing on the Side
- Offer a variety of dressings on the side, like cilantro lime vinaigrette or creamy avocado dressing, allowing guests to customize their flavors.
How to Perfect Grilled Mexican Shrimp Salad
To elevate your Grilled Mexican Shrimp Salad, consider these expert tips for optimal flavor and presentation.
Marinate the shrimp longer: Allowing the shrimp to marinate for at least 30 minutes enhances their flavor and tenderness.
Use fresh ingredients: Fresh vegetables and herbs significantly improve taste. Opt for ripe avocados and vine-ripened tomatoes when possible.
Adjust spice levels: Feel free to modify the amount of ancho chili powder based on your spice preference. Start with less if you’re unsure.
Grill corn properly: Ensure you grill the corn until it’s slightly charred, which adds a delightful smokiness to the salad.
Best Side Dishes for Grilled Mexican Shrimp Salad
Grilled Mexican Shrimp Salad pairs well with various side dishes that complement its vibrant flavors. Here are some excellent options:
Mexican Street Corn: Charred corn topped with lime, cheese, and spices adds a tasty twist that mirrors flavors already in the salad.
Guacamole: Creamy avocado dip served with tortilla chips offers a rich contrast to the fresh salad components.
Cilantro Lime Rice: Fluffy rice flavored with cilantro and lime is a perfect base that rounds out the meal beautifully.
Black Bean Salsa: A zesty mix of black beans, tomatoes, onion, and lime juice enhances protein content while remaining light.
Roasted Vegetables: Seasonal veggies roasted until caramelized bring additional textures and nutrients to your table.
Quesadillas: Cheese-filled tortillas add heartiness to your meal; consider adding peppers or chicken for extra flavor.
Common Mistakes to Avoid
To create the perfect Grilled Mexican Shrimp Salad, it’s important to avoid common pitfalls. Here are some mistakes to watch out for:
- Skipping the marinade – Marinating the shrimp is crucial. It infuses flavor and ensures a juicy result. Be sure to let them sit in the marinade for at least 15 minutes.
- Overcooking the shrimp – Shrimp cooks quickly. If you leave it on the grill too long, it can become tough and rubbery. Aim for just 1.5 minutes per side until they turn golden.
- Neglecting seasoning – Underseasoning can lead to bland flavors. Always season both the shrimp and vegetables well for maximum taste.
- Forgetting to soak skewers – Wooden skewers can catch fire if not soaked properly. Ensure they soak in water for at least 30 minutes before grilling.
- Not using fresh ingredients – Fresh produce enhances the salad’s flavor and texture. Choose fresh corn, ripe avocados, and vibrant greens for the best results.

Storage & Reheating Instructions
Refrigerator Storage
- Store leftovers in an airtight container.
- The salad keeps well for up to 2 days in the fridge.
Freezing Grilled Mexican Shrimp Salad
- It is not recommended to freeze this salad, as fresh vegetables do not thaw well.
- However, you can freeze grilled shrimp separately for up to 3 months.
Reheating Grilled Mexican Shrimp Salad
- Oven – Preheat the oven to 350°F (175°C). Place shrimp on a baking sheet and heat for about 10 minutes.
- Microwave – Heat in short intervals of 30 seconds until warm, being cautious not to overcook.
- Stovetop – Reheat in a skillet over medium heat, stirring frequently until warmed through.
Frequently Asked Questions
What is Grilled Mexican Shrimp Salad?
Grilled Mexican Shrimp Salad is a flavorful dish made with marinated shrimp, grilled corn, black beans, fresh veggies, and cheese. It’s perfect as a main course or side dish.
How can I customize my Grilled Mexican Shrimp Salad?
You can customize your salad by adding your favorite ingredients such as bell peppers, radishes, or different types of cheese. Adjust spices according to your taste preferences.
Can I use frozen shrimp for this recipe?
Yes, you can use frozen shrimp! Just be sure to thaw them completely and pat them dry before marinating.
What dressing goes well with Grilled Mexican Shrimp Salad?
A cilantro lime vinaigrette complements this salad beautifully! You can also use ranch or any light dressing you prefer.
Final Thoughts
The Grilled Mexican Shrimp Salad is not only delicious but also versatile. It combines fresh ingredients that bring joy in every bite! Feel free to customize it with your favorite toppings or dressings for a personal touch. Enjoy this delightful dish any time of year!

Grilled Mexican Shrimp Salad
Grilled Mexican Shrimp Salad is a vibrant and satisfying dish that brings the fresh flavors of summer to your table. This tantalizing salad features juicy marinated shrimp, smoky grilled corn, and a colorful assortment of crisp vegetables, making it perfect for casual family dinners or festive gatherings. Packed with protein, healthy fats, and fiber, this nutritious meal is not only delicious but also easy to prepare in under 30 minutes. Top it off with creamy avocado and crumbled queso fresco for an eye-catching presentation that will impress your family and friends.
- Total Time: 30 minutes
- Yield: Serves 4
Ingredients
- 1 lb large raw shrimp (peeled and deveined)
- 1/4 cup olive oil
- 1 1/2 tbsp fresh thyme (chopped)
- 1 1/2 tbsp ancho chili powder
- 2 ears fresh corn (grilled)
- 6–8 cups green leaf lettuce
- 15 oz can black beans (rinsed and drained)
- 1 large tomato (chopped)
- 1 large avocado (chopped)
- 4 oz queso fresco cheese (crumbled)
Instructions
- Preheat the grill over medium heat. Clean the grate.
- In a bowl, whisk olive oil, thyme, ancho chili powder, lime zest, and garlic. Marinate shrimp on wooden skewers.
- Spray corn with oil and season. Grill for 14-16 minutes until tender.
- Increase grill heat to high, then grill shrimp for about 1.5 minutes per side until golden.
- Assemble salad: combine greens, corn, tomatoes, black beans, avocado, cheese, and top with grilled shrimp.
- Prep Time: 15 minutes
- Cook Time: 15 minutes
- Category: Main
- Method: Grilling
- Cuisine: Mexican
Nutrition
- Serving Size: 1 serving
- Calories: 360
- Sugar: 3g
- Sodium: 500mg
- Fat: 18g
- Saturated Fat: 3g
- Unsaturated Fat: 15g
- Trans Fat: 0g
- Carbohydrates: 30g
- Fiber: 10g
- Protein: 24g
- Cholesterol: 170mg
Keywords: For added flavor, let the shrimp marinate for at least 30 minutes. Customize by adding other veggies like bell peppers or radishes. Serve with cilantro lime vinaigrette or your favorite dressing.